📜  两行省略 (1)

📅  最后修改于: 2023-12-03 15:35:57.167000             🧑  作者: Mango

两行省略

在编程中,我们经常需要处理数据,有时候数据可能会非常庞大,不便于直接查看或者处理。这时候,我们就会用到“两行省略”的技巧。

什么是“两行省略”

“两行省略”是指在数据过长时,只输出前面几行和最后几行,省略中间部分。比如:

data = 'abcdefghijklmn'

# 输出前两行和最后两行
print(data[:2])
print('...')
print(data[-2:])

输出结果为:

ab
...
mn

这样做的好处是,可以使输出结果更加简洁明了,而且可以节省内存空间。

应用场景

“两行省略”技巧在各种编程语言中都有应用,比如:

  • 在 Python 中,可以用于处理文本文件、日志文件等;
  • 在 Java 中,可以用于处理大规模数据,比如读取 Web 日志;
  • 在 C++ 中,可以用于处理大型数列,比如计算斐波那契数列的前 n 项;

在实际编程中,只要遇到需要处理大规模数据的情况,就可以考虑使用“两行省略”技巧。

总结

“两行省略”是一种很实用的技巧,可以用于处理大规模数据,既能使输出结果更加简洁明了,又能节省内存空间。在实际编程中,需要注意数据的范围和数据的格式,以免出现错误。